Empirical estimation of saturated soil-paste electrical conductivity in the EU using pedotransfer functions and Quantile Regression Forests: A mapping approach based on LUCAS topsoil data

Soil Electrical conductivity (EC) is a measure of the ability of soil to conduct an electric current, which is primarily influenced by the concentration of soluble salts in the soil solution that takes place principally through water-filled pores.
